fix(plane): resolve issue states per-project instead of hardcoded enduro UUIDs (ORCH-10)
ORCH-10 root cause: PLANE_STATES was a global dict hardcoding enduro-trails
UUIDs. The webhook comparison only
matched ET UUID (b873d9eb) and silently ignored the ORCH in_progress UUID
(e331bfb3), blocking pipeline start for all orchestrator-project tasks.
Changes:
- src/plane_sync.py:
* Rename PLANE_STATES -> _DEFAULT_STATES (enduro UUIDs kept as safe fallback).
* PLANE_STATES preserved as alias to _DEFAULT_STATES (backward compat).
* Add get_project_states(project_id) -> {logical_key: state_uuid}:
fetches Plane API GET /projects/<id>/states/, maps by state name,
caches per project_id, falls back to _DEFAULT_STATES on API failure.
* Add _STATES_CACHE: dict, reload_project_states(project_id=None).
* Add _PLANE_NAME_TO_KEY mapping and _STAGE_TO_STATE_KEY for clean lookup.
* Add stage_to_state(stage, project_id) using get_project_states().
* update_issue_state() uses stage_to_state() instead of STAGE_TO_STATE dict.
* set_issue_{needs_input,in_review,blocked,done,in_progress,stage_state}()
all resolve state UUID via get_project_states(project_id) instead of
the global PLANE_STATES dict.
- src/webhooks/plane.py:
* handle_issue_updated: import get_project_states, resolve proj_states per
incoming project_id, compare new_state against proj_states["in_progress"],
proj_states["approved"], proj_states["rejected"].
* start_pipeline QG-0 blocked path: use get_project_states(plane_project_id)
instead of PLANE_STATES["blocked"].
- tests/test_orch10_states.py: 23 new tests covering:
* get_project_states returns correct UUIDs for both ET and ORCH projects.
* API failure / empty response / None project_id -> _DEFAULT_STATES fallback.
* Caching and reload_project_states (per-project and full flush).
* stage_to_state() per-project resolution.
* Webhook in_progress triggers pipeline for BOTH b873d9eb (ET) and e331bfb3 (ORCH).
* Webhook approved/rejected routes correctly per project.
* PLANE_STATES alias and _DEFAULT_STATES backward compat.
